#627f68 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#627f68 is composed of 38.4% red, 49.8%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 22.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 18.1% yellow and 50.2% black. It has a hue angle of 132.4 degrees, a saturation of 12.9% and a lightness of 44.1%. #627f68 color hex could be obtained by blending #c4fed0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#627f68

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040504 is the darkest color, while #f9faf9 is the lightest one.
